The MS2N04-B0BTN-ASDK1-NNNNN-NN synchronous servo motor from Bosch Rexroth Indramat is a high-performance member of the MS2N Synchronous Servo Motors series designed for precision motion control in industrial drive systems. This three-phase motor features Pole Pairs: 5 and a winding inductance of 27.52 mH, delivering rapid response and stability in dynamic operations. Equipped with a holding brake rated at 24 VDC ±10%, it ensures secure braking and positioning when power is removed. The primary function of this motor is to provide smooth, accurate torque for applications such as machine tools, packaging machinery, and automated assembly lines where precise speed and position regulation are critical.
This servo motor is built to exacting technical standards, with a Keyway output shaft and a shaft sealing ring conforming to DIN 748 specifications for enhanced shaft durability and contamination resistance. The motor housing is coated with RAL 9005 varnish, offering excellent protection against corrosion and abrasion in demanding environments. Rated for operation within a temperature range of 0 to 40 °C, the device maintains optimal performance under specified ambient conditions. The unit’s design supports integration with foreign converters, facilitating flexibility in control system architectures. Its electrostatic-safe construction and clockwise shaft rotation direction guarantee reliable operation even under axial and radial loading conditions.
Additional features include compliance with CE certification and cUL recognition, assuring adherence to international safety and performance regulations. The motor classification of 3K22 per EN IEC 60721-3-3 underscores its suitability for permanent industrial use, withstanding sinusoidal vibration profiles during stationary operation. Delivered with protective covers, an auxiliary rating plate, and comprehensive safety notes, the unit is intended exclusively for horizontal mounting in commercial machinery. Proper grounding, brake functionality verification, and adherence to manufacturer guidelines are essential for safe operation.
